Suprise suprise Brief outline, When riding my 99 CBR Fireblade with the lights on, the battery slowly dies and refuses to start the next time i try to start it, or just cuts out in heavy traffic on the May day run, not embarassing at all! However with the lights off it runs an charges fine.
When i put a multimeter across the terminals with the lights off I have 12.5 volts going up to 14 Volts when revved. With the lights on tho you can see the voltage dropping from 12.5 volts an no increase in voltage when you rev the bike.
So........ Typical Honda Reg/rec or generator or something else ?

I thought my rectifier was fooked, the local bike mechanic showed me a quick test to see if it is ok......
start the bike.... turn on dipped beam.... rev the bike whilst watching the light.... if the light gets slightly brighter when you rev it, then the rectifier is working.
If not then it needs checking out with meters etc. Not sure how to do that. but it may also just be a dirty contact on a plug to the rectifier.
